We make compote and I don't know what it's called in your country, I'll explain it like this: we bring sugar and water to a boil and cut the pears into cubes and pour lemon juice over them so they stay white. When the sugar and water are thick enough, I add the pears and cook without stirring for about half an hour. I pour it into jars and it's a pleasure for me with my morning coffee. I make it with almost any fruit, the rest of the pears go into brandy
